Shutter Story offers a slow, introspective take on interactive storytelling through the lens of photography. Instead of conventional dialogue or action, players discover narrative fragments by capturing the world around them. Each photo tells a partial truth, and the full picture only emerges through curiosity, timing, and analysis. The process of taking a photograph becomes an act of investigation — every shot matters, and every missed moment leaves questions unanswered.

Capturing the Invisible

At its heart, Shutter Story is about attention. The player’s task is to see what others overlook: reflections in glass, brief light flashes, and the interplay of movement and silence. The environment constantly shifts, hiding secrets within ordinary scenes. Players must choose where to look, when to capture, and how to interpret what appears in the frame.

  • Focus on light direction to uncover objects concealed in shadow.
  • Use motion blur intentionally to reveal unseen patterns.
  • Analyze angles that reflect alternate perspectives of the same scene.
  • Return to previous areas to photograph subtle temporal changes.

Photo Mechanics and Story Reconstruction

Each captured image in Shutter Story is stored and categorized for later examination. By studying their collection, players can reconstruct events, identify connections, and form hypotheses. Some clues are visual, others contextual — sound cues, weather conditions, or even the presence of animals may hold meaning. The player acts as both observer and detective, piecing together a fragmented reality through environmental storytelling.

  • Compare photos taken at different times to spot missing details.
  • Group similar objects or symbols to identify recurring themes.
  • Use environmental context to deduce story progression.
  • Tag and annotate photos to build personal narrative theories.

Light, Time, and Reaction

Timing is a fundamental element. Many clues exist only briefly — a door creaks open for a second, or a shadow moves when light shifts. Capturing these fleeting visuals requires patience and anticipation. The more players learn about the world’s rhythm, the better they can predict when and where to aim the camera for meaningful results.

  • Track environmental cycles to predict when rare phenomena appear.
  • Experiment with exposure timing during day-to-night transitions.
  • Observe reflections at specific times for hidden imagery.
  • Listen for subtle audio cues that signal visual triggers.

The Power of Seeing

Shutter Story encourages players to find meaning in stillness. It rewards focus, curiosity, and thoughtful observation. By learning to see differently, players uncover not just secrets within the game world but insights about the act of perception itself. Every photograph is both documentation and interpretation, turning the camera into an instrument of discovery and understanding.
